Touched by the need to rescue children being used as prostitutes, the Iyaniwura Children Care Foundation has expressed its disappointment at the Lagos chapter of the Nigerian Labour Congress for allowing the Owutu Diamond Women Initiative, a prostitute group, which had some children as its members to march during the May Day rally. The foundation is drawing a battle line with the labour body. Funmi Ogundare reports

On May 1, a day set aside to commemorate the International Workers’ Day, the Owutu Diamond Women Initiative, a prostitute group, which has some young adults among its members, were among those who filed out alongside other labour groups.
At the rally held at Agege Stadium, Lagos, the group carried a banner with the inscription, ‘Sex Workers Need Rights, Not Rescue’, to demand for their rights.
